Pegarding the structure of `SO_(2) and SeO_(2)` which of the following is true-

A

The gaseous `SO_(2)` and `SeO_(2)` have same V - shaped molecule both in solid and gas phase

B

At room temperature both `SO_(2)` and `SeO_(2)` are solids.

C

In the solid phase the structure of `SO_(2)` is V - shaped discrete molecule but `SeO_(2)` is cyclic trimeric

D

In solid phase the sturcture of `SO_(2)` is V - shaped discrete molecule but `SeO_(2)` has linear polymeric chain

Text Solution

AI Generated Solution

The correct Answer is:
To analyze the structures of \( SO_2 \) and \( SeO_2 \), we will break down the characteristics of each compound step by step. ### Step 1: Analyze the structure of \( SO_2 \) - **Sulfur Dioxide (\( SO_2 \))**: - The molecular geometry of \( SO_2 \) is determined by the presence of one sulfur atom bonded to two oxygen atoms. - The Lewis structure shows that sulfur forms two double bonds with the oxygen atoms, resulting in a bent or V-shaped molecular geometry. - Additionally, there is one lone pair of electrons on the sulfur atom, which contributes to the V-shape. ### Step 2: Analyze the structure of \( SeO_2 \) - **Selenium Dioxide (\( SeO_2 \))**: - The molecular structure of \( SeO_2 \) is different from that of \( SO_2 \). - At room temperature, \( SeO_2 \) exists as a solid and has a polymeric structure. - The structure consists of an infinite chain of selenium and oxygen atoms, where selenium forms double bonds with oxygen, leading to a non-planar infinite chain structure. ### Step 3: Compare the structures of \( SO_2 \) and \( SeO_2 \) - **Comparison**: - \( SO_2 \) is a V-shaped molecule in both solid and gaseous forms, characterized by discrete molecular units. - In contrast, \( SeO_2 \) is a solid at room temperature and has a linear polymeric chain structure, not a discrete molecule. ### Conclusion: Based on the analysis: - The correct statement is that in the solid phase, the structure of \( SO_2 \) is V-shaped and discrete, while \( SeO_2 \) has a linear polymeric chain structure. ### Final Answer: The correct option is that \( SO_2 \) is V-shaped and discrete, while \( SeO_2 \) has a linear polymeric chain structure. ---
